Transaction 5ddddb4094002f37c8b7ac1ec91bc233b52e6532ad10fe341b6e1dbc3916d056

2 Input
1 Outputs
  • 5ddddb4094002f37c8b7ac1ec91bc233b52e6532ad10fe341b6e1dbc3916d056:0
  • value  15996398
    address  1JsfNPNZK2z8FhUy8idLixGGnuaAgi8bh2